Abstract
Cloud computing is disrupting the IT landscape across all types of organizations. In 2014 JP Morgan formed a group to design and build a cloud platform that will support thousands of applications written by 10’s of thousands of developers and used by hundreds of thousands of end users. This presentation will provide an overview of the goals and rationale of JP Morgan’s cloud platform and the implications of being a developer on this type of platform.

Bio
John McTeague is a Cloud Services Architect at JP Morgan Chase in Glasgow, working on designing the next generation internal cloud platform and helping the development community build applications that take advantage of the clouds capabilities. With 15 years’ experience across Financial Services developing applications in a variety of languages ranging from Cobol to Java and Go, he focuses today on promoting Cloud Native application patterns and making common sense design decisions for applications. John is also a graduate of Strathclyde University, obtaining a BSc in Computer Science in 2001.
